What is FCC?
Primary conversion process in petroleum refinery.
The unit which utilizes a micro-spherodial catalyst (zeolitic catalyst) which fluidizes when properly aerated.
The purpose is to convert high-boiling petroleum fractions (gas oil) to high-value, high-octane gasoline and heating oil.
Why use Circulating Fluidized Bed in FCC?
Compared with Fixed Bed, Fluidized Bed
CFB – fast fluidization regime
CFB good for catalyst size < 0.2 mm
Excellent in:
Gas-solid effective contact
Catalyst effectiveness
Catalyst internal temperature control
Catalyst regeneration
Operating Characteristics
Particle Diameter = 150 m
Geldart Classification = A
Temperature = 650 0C
Pressure = 100 kPa
Superficial gas velocity = 10 m/s
Bed depth = 0.85 m
Fresh feed flow rate = 300,000 kg/hr
Catalyst to oil ratio = 4.8
